Abstract

DICHO DISPOSITIVO COMPRENDE: UNA UNIDAD INDIVIDUAL EXTERIOR (1) QUE INCLUYE UN COMPRESOR (2) UNA VALVULA DE 4 CONDUCTOS (3) UN INTERCAMBIADOR DE CALOR EXTERIOR (4), UN ACUMULADOR (8). UNA PLURALIDAD DE UNIDADES INTERIORES (9A 9C) SON CONECTADAS EN PARALELO A LA UNIDAD EXTERIOR (1) A TRAVES DE UNOS PRIMEROS MEDIOS DE TRANSPORTE REFRIGERANTE (13) Y UNOS SEGUNDOS MEDIOS DE TRANSPORTE REFRIGERANTE (14). VALVULAS DE PUESTA EN MARCHA (20) SELECTIVAMENTE CONECTADAS DE UN EXTREMO DE LAS UNIDADES INTERIORES (9A - 9C) A CUALQUIERA DE LOS MEDIOS (13, 14). UN TERCER MEDIO TRANSPORTADOR REFRIGERANTE (22) TIENE UN EXTREMO CONECTADO AL OTRO EXTREMO DE LAS UNIDADES (9A - 9C) A TRAVES DE UNOS PRIMEROS CONTROLADORES DE FLUJO (21) Y EL OTRO EXTREMO ES CONECTADO A CUALQUIERA DE LOS MEDIOS (13, 14) A TRAVES DE UN SEGUNDO CONTROLADOR DE FLUJO (23).
